Gateway State Bank v. Dacchille
Opinion of the Court
In an action brought on by a motion for summary judgment in lieu of complaint, the defendant Anthony B. Dacchille appeals from stated portions of an order of the Supreme Court, Richmond County (Sangiorgio, J.), dated November 21, 1995, which, inter alia, in effect denied those branches of his motion which were (1) to direct the assignees of the plaintiff, Gateway State Bank, to file a satisfaction piece, (2) for an accounting, (3) for the return of surplus money, and (4) for discovery.
